American swimmer Dara Torres is 41 year old and nine times Olympic champion. At Olympics 2008 she took the silver medal in 4×100 meter relay swimming.

Torres is included in a small group of acting sports elite, which continues performing in the age of 40 years and more.  Carlos Lopez, a marathon runner from Portugal, won a gold Olympic medal  being 37 years. Jack Foster from New Zealand was 40 years, when he represented his country at Munich and Montreal Olympics in 1972 and 1976. A 49-year-old Frenchwoman Jeannie Longo-Chiprelli, an Olympic champion of Atlanta 1996, required just a few seconds to enter the three leaders on her seventh Olympics in Beijing. She was quicker than many of those who have not yet been born when she was a champion.

Each of these cases are rather an exception than a rule, and an average age of current Olympic team members is 24-26 years. Why even the best athletes leave big sport with age and others manage to stay?

Joyner responds: «Maximum oxygen uptake begins to decrease after the age of thirty. But well-trained athletes may delay the time before the end of the fourth ten, or even the beginning of the fifth. Normal people lose an average of 1% of maximum oxygen uptake a year. But those who train constantly lose only 0.5% a year». One should add that Dara Torres, according to sports commentators, is also a master of sprint, in other words, her success is based not only on capacity of lungs, but largely on strength of muscles.

13offi_Further a 12-time Olympic medalist Dara Torres tried her hand at a new field - a 41-year-old swimmer, who won three silver medals at the Beijing Olympics, took part in designer’s Charles Nolan fashion show, during New York Fashion Week.

A sportswoman came to the podium twice: in a white-blue striped sleeveless top and dark blue shorts with a two-year daughter, Tessa and later -in a black ruched faux dress from jersey and silk taffeta.

«There was one girl model, which, in her own words, was very nervous, and I told her participation in the Olympic swim irritates more», - said Dara. Nevertheless, athlete was still worrying - she was afraid to stumble on the catwalk. «I’m not used to walk on high heels, I always wear shoes with flat sole», - she said.

According to Nolan, Dara Torres is ideally suited to demonstrate his models. «She served as a source of inspiration to me, - says the designer. – One case is to look good at 41 years, and another - enter the Olympic team, compete with 16-year-olds and win a silver medal».
